MandRo Teahouse is a welcoming bubble tea store on Park Street in Alameda, California, where boba drinks and Korean-style shaved ice come together for an easygoing dessert stop. Located at 1321 Park St in Alameda’s downtown area, it is a convenient place to pause during an afternoon out, meet a friend, or pick up something sweet after a meal. With a 4.3 rating from 49 reviews, MandRo Teahouse is recognized by local visitors for its dessert-focused menu, friendly service, and generous portions.
Bingsoo, also known as Korean shaved ice, is a standout reason many customers seek out MandRo Teahouse in Alameda. Reviewers specifically mention the Mango Bingsoo and Chocolate Bingsoo, with the mango option described as delicious and plentiful enough to share. Strawberry is another flavor that has earned enthusiastic feedback. For guests who enjoy tailoring a dessert to their taste, the bingsoo includes a serving of condensed milk, and reviewers note that extra condensed milk can be added. It is a simple touch that makes the experience feel especially personal, whether you prefer a light drizzle or a richer finish.
The drink menu gives bubble tea fans plenty to explore alongside dessert. Customers have ordered options such as roasted milk tea with boba and a matcha latte with taro, making MandRo Teahouse a natural stop for people looking for tea-based drinks with familiar add-ins. The shop is especially suited to a casual visit with a partner, friends, or family: share a large bingsoo, choose your own beverage, and settle into a relaxed sweet break. Feedback reflects different individual tastes, so trying a flavor combination that fits your preferences can be part of the fun.
For anyone searching for bubble tea in Alameda, CA, or a dessert spot near Park Street, MandRo Teahouse offers a focused mix of boba drinks and shaved-ice treats. It is open Wednesday through Monday from 12:30 PM, with later hours until 10 PM on Friday and Saturday; it is closed Tuesday. We tried this dessert and boba tea place yesterday, and it was absolutely fantastic! My wife and I shared the Mango Bingsoo and it was delicious and plentiful! We added an extra condensed milk for .50 (the dessert includes 1 serving of condensed milk, but I was happy we had 2 servings). This was is such a unique dessert experience. It consists of a milk-based shaved ice, with a generous layer of fresh mango slices and mango syrup on the top, and some mango pieces syrup and possibly condensed milk inside as well. It is kind of pricey as desserts go ($18 incl tip), but it was large enough for 2-3 ppl, and the price seemed fair once we received/ devoured the dish! If you have 3 adults sharing you might spring for the large size, which cost a few bucks more as I recall.
